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. NYSCF, CBR collaborate to customize creation of high-quality stem cell lines

The New York Stem Cell Foundation and Cbr Systems, Inc. DBA Cord Blood Registry today announced a collaboration to customize the creation of high-quality stem cell lines. NYSCF will create induced pluripotent stem (iPS) cell lines from umbilical cord tissue collected after birth from healthy newborns provided by CBR.

Haber's Electromolecular Propulsion technology offers high molecular separation speeds

Haber, Inc. ("Haber"), (OTC: HABE), a Delaware corporation headquartered in Arlington, Mass., with proprietary technologies in the separations sciences and environmentally friendly processing of gold bearing ores, announced today that it has formed a wholly owned subsidiary incorporated in Delaware called "EMP Diagnostics Inc." ("EDI"). The business of the new company will focus on the application of Haber's Electromolecular Propulsion technology (EMP). EMP is a separation technology that achieves unrivaled molecular separation speeds and has other unique capabilities not attainable with electrophoresis or liquid chromatography.

BioCryst Pharmaceuticals signs agreements with two additional partners

BioCryst Pharmaceuticals, Inc. today announced that it has signed agreements with two additional partners who will exclusively represent BioCryst and its anti-viral peramivir for influenza stockpiling opportunities for territories outside of the U.S. BioCryst's new partners are Merck Serono for Europe, Russia, Canada and Singapore and Hikma Pharmaceuticals PLC for the Middle East and North Africa (MENA) region, excluding Israel.

American Heart Association honors UVA professor for contributions to cardiovascular research

Robert M. Carey, MD, Professor of Medicine at the University of Virginia School of Medicine, has been named a Distinguished Scientist of the American Heart Association for his "extraordinary contributions" to cardiovascular research.
